Law Clerk Regulatory Investigations
Job Description & How to Apply Below
Elevate your legal expertise as a Law Clerk in Toronto, Ontario with a hybrid work model. Collaborate on regulatory investigations and litigation involving securities law matters.
This full-time contract role invites you to support high-profile investigations in a fast-paced legal setting. As a seasoned Law Clerk, you will manage complex documentation and evidence while working closely with litigation counsel and investigative teams. Your legal skills and attention to detail will be vital in maintaining accuracy and confidentiality.
Key Responsibilities:
• Review evidence and conduct legal research for investigations
• Prepare and manage court and tribunal documents
• Organize and manage electronic disclosure using eDiscovery tools
• Provide support during hearings and trials
• Liaise with stakeholders including court officials and witnesses
Requirements:
• 5+ years as a Law Clerk in litigation or regulatory settings
• Completion of a two-year Law Clerk program or eligibility for ILCO
• Strong knowledge of eDiscovery software and compliance
• Familiarity with Ontario Securities Act and related legislation
• Exceptional drafting and organizational skills with deadline management
